At an activated sludge wastewater treatment plant receiving 3.25 MGD, the nal euent suspended solids concentration averages 21.2 mg/L. What would the calculated MCRT value be when the aeration basin carries 2,050 mg/L MLSS and wastes 0.0550 MGD. The waste activated sludge has a concentration of 7,980 mg/L. The aeration tank has a volume of 1.00 MG and the secondary clarier has an operational volume of 0.250 MG. a. 2.5 days *b. 5.0 days c. 7.5 days d. 15 days e. 42 days Solution: M CRT (days) = M LSS in aeration tank (lbs) + M LSS in clarif ier (lbs) SS ef f luent (lbs/day) + SS W AS (lbs/day) M LSS in aeration tank (lbs) = 1 ∗ 2050 ∗ 8.34 = 17, 097lbs M LSS in clarif ier (lbs) = 0.25 ∗ 2050 ∗ 8.34 = 4, 274.3lbs SS ef f luent (lbs/day) = 3.25M GD ∗ 21.2mg/l ∗ 8.34 = 574.6lbs/day SS W AS (lbs/day) = 0.055M GD ∗ 7, 980mg/l ∗ 8.34 = 3, 660.4lbs/day Plugging in the values calculated above: M CRT (days) = 17, 097.6 + 4, 274.3 = 4.8 = 5 days 574.6 + 3, 660.4 82. How many gallons of wastewater would 600 feet of 6-inch diameter pipe hold, approximately? a. 740. *b. 880. c. 900. d. 930. Solution: Diameter=6" Length=600' V olume =  6 2 gallons Ï€ 2 D ∗ L = 0.785 ∗ ∗ 600 f t3 ∗ 7.48 = 881 gallons 4 12 f t3  Page 12 of 16 WATR 048 - Fall 2021 Practice Exam 1 - Solution Shabbir Basrai 83. Calculate the volatile solids reduction in an anaerobic digester given the following information: Raw sludge feed to digester: 73.7 % VS and digested sludge: 57.2 %VS *a. 52.3% b. 64% c. 16.5% d. 42% Solution: The VS reduction of the digester is provided by the Van Kleeck equation Digester V S reduction(%) = V Sin − V Sout ∗ 100 V Sin − V Sin ∗ V Sout Digester V S reduction(%) = 0.737 − 0.572 ∗ 100 = 52.3% 0.737 − 0.737 ∗ 0.572 84. The desired trickling lter recirculation ratio is 1.4. If the primary euent ow is 4.4 MGD what is the trickling lter euent ow that needs to be recirculated. a. 3.1 MGD *b. 6.2 MGD c. 1.9 MGD d. 4.7 MGD Solution: RR = QR QR =⇒ QR = 1.4 ∗ 4.4 = 6.2M GD =⇒ 1.4 = QI 4.4 85. The chlorine demand is 4.8 mg/l and a chlorine residual is 0.75 mg/l is desired. For a ow of 2.8 MGD, how many pounds per day should the chlorinator be set to deliver. *a. 130 b. 116 c. 112 d. 18 e. 16 Solution: Chlorine dosage = chlorine demand + chlorine residual chlorine dosage = 4.8 + 0.75 = 5.55mg/l To calculate pounds per day, applying the pounds formula: lbs/day = conc.(mg/l) ∗ f low(M GD) ∗ 8.34 = 2.8 ∗ 5.55 ∗ 8.34 = 130 Page 13 of 16 lbs day WATR 048 - Fall 2021 Practice Exam 1 - Solution Shabbir Basrai 86. What is the velocity (ft/s) of a 3 MGD ow in a 12 in. diameter pipe. Assume the pipe is owing full. *a. 5.9 ft/s b. 0.3 ft/s c. 2.5 ft/s d. 4 ft/s Solution: Q=V ∗A =⇒ V = Q =⇒ V A ft s   3 M G 1, 000, 000 gal f t3 day  ∗ ∗ ∗    ft  1440 ∗ 60s day MG 7.48gal =  = 5.9  12 2  s 0.785 ∗ f t2 12  87. A 40 acre wastewater treatment pond receives a ow of 0.6 MGD. If the pond is operated at a depth of 4ft. What is the detention time of this pond? a. 22 days b. 52 days *c. 87 days d. 97 days e. 16 days Solution: P ond detention time = V olume = F low (40 ∗ 4)acre − f t = 87 days f t3 acre − f t gal ∗ ∗ 0.6 ∗ 106 day 7.48gal 43, 560f t3 88. What is the grit production rate (cu. ft/MG) if 46 cu. ft of grit is removed every ve days and the daily plant ow averages 2 MGD. a. 12 cu. ft/MG b. 23 cu. ft/MG *c. 4.6 cu. ft/MG d. 9.2 cu. ft/MG Solution:  f t3   46 f t3 day f t3 Grit P roduction Rate = ∗  = 4.6   MG 5days 2 M G MG Page 14 of 16 WATR 048 - Fall 2021 Practice Exam 1 - Solution Shabbir Basrai 89. At a 2.5 MGD wastewater treatment plant the primary clarier has a detention time of 2 hours. How many gallons does this clarier hold? a. 104,000 gallons *b. 208,000 gallons c. 250,000 gallons d. 500,000 gallons e. 5,000,000 gallons Solution: Clarif ier detention time (hr) = Clarif ier volume(gal) Inf luent f low (gal/hr) =⇒ Clarif ier volume(gal) = Clarif ier detention time (hr) ∗ Inf luent f low (gal/hr)    gal day  = 208, 333 gals ∗ =⇒ Clarif ier volume(gal) = 2 hrs ∗ 2.5 ∗ 106 day 24 hrs 90.
